jquery获得父级删除 jquery找到父级标签
jquery,有段代码(不全),$(this).parent().children().removeClass(db...
1、jquery中$(this).parent()是当前标记的父标记的意思。在使用 $(this).parent()的时候,需要对他进行操作,要先得到他的父级,然后在进行操作。
公司主营业务:成都网站制作、网站设计、移动网站开发等业务。帮助企业客户真正实现互联网宣传,提高企业的竞争能力。创新互联公司是一支青春激扬、勤奋敬业、活力青春激扬、勤奋敬业、活力澎湃、和谐高效的团队。公司秉承以“开放、自由、严谨、自律”为核心的企业文化,感谢他们对我们的高要求,感谢他们从不同领域给我们带来的挑战,让我们激情的团队有机会用头脑与智慧不断的给客户带来惊喜。创新互联公司推出阆中免费做网站回馈大家。
2、(this).Children(dd)//这样就选择了当前鼠标下的dd元素啦。
3、输入jquery代码:(li).hover(function () { (this).find(dd).css(display, inline);});浏览器运行index.html页面,此时当鼠标移动到li上时,它的字元素dd通过$(this)的方式获取被显示了出来。
4、$parent.append($city); }); $(.tab1_tag2_con a).click(function(){ $(this).remove(); }); }); 删除tab1_tag2_con a里原有的就可以,但是不能删除后来添加的。
固定定位后怎么消除父元素
思路:拿到要删除的元素,通过 parentNode 定位到该元素的父元素,再通过r emoveChild 移除该元素。以上,最终删掉的是ul元素。
除非子元素全部是绝对定位的,否则只要有静态子元素的宽度超过父元素的宽度就会撑开父元素。
楼主如果是这样的话只能让a元素根据窗口定位了,position: fixed;因为子元素的父元素有定位的时候就是根据父元素做参考然后定位的,如果父元素没有定位就会向上查找,如果都没有定位那么久根据窗口进行定位。
首先,打开html编辑器,新建html文件,例如:index.html。在index.html中的标签中,输入html代码:按钮。浏览器运行index.html页面,此时按钮被固定在距离上方40px,左侧250px的位置。
静态定位的元素不会受到top,bottom,left,right影响。固定定位:元素的位置相对于浏览器窗口是固定位置。margin-bottom 和margin-right的值不再对文档流中的元素产生影响,因为该元素已经脱离了文档流。
父容器使用相对定位,子元素使用绝对定位后,这样子元素的位置不再相对于浏览器左上角,而是相对于父窗口左上角。
jquery删除本元素的父类元素DIV,需要使用$(this)
1、新建HTML文件。引入jquery.min.js文件。创建div和按钮并添加class样式。接下来需要创建css样式。创建js点击事件。当点击按钮移除div元素。点击按钮效果如图所示。
2、该方法不会把匹配的元素从 jQuery 对象中删除,因而可以在将来再使用这些匹配的元素。但除了这个元素本身得以保留之外,remove不会保留元素的 jQuery 数据,其他的比如绑定的事件、附加的数据等都会被移除。
3、删除:使用jQuery的remove方法。添加:使用jQuery的append、after等多个方法,这些不同的方法是用来决定标签添加的相对位置。举例如下:以内部追加方法append为例。
分享文章:jquery获得父级删除 jquery找到父级标签
标题网址:http://scyanting.com/article/dissecc.html